[Sunken Electric New Product Information] Output voltage variable type switching regulator IC "NR264S" equipped with lightweight load high efficiency function.
The NR264S is a synchronous rectification switching regulator IC that incorporates a power MOSFET. To achieve high efficiency under light load conditions, it operates in pulse skip mode during light loads. It operates stably with low ESR capacitors such as ceramic capacitors due to its peak current control method. It is equipped with comprehensive protection features including overcurrent protection, low input voltage protection, and thermal protection. 【Features】 - Synchronous rectification type - Operating modes Steady state: Current mode PWM control Light load: Pulse skip operation - Maximum efficiency (VIN = 12 V, VOUT = 5 V) Steady state: 94% Light load (Iout = 10 mA): 86% - Stabilizes output with low ESR ceramic capacitors - Reduces the number of external components (fixed output 5 V) - Allows setting of soft start time with external capacitors - Enable function - Frequency limitation function (limits pulse skip frequency at light load to 28 kHz) - Protection features Overcurrent protection (OCP): Latch type, automatic recovery Thermal shutdown protection (TSD): Automatic recovery Low input voltage malfunction prevention circuit (UVLO) Output short-circuit protection: Burst oscillation operation (Hiccup)

New product for temperature sensing wire for monitoring abnormal temperatures of electrical wires installed on electrical equipment.
This product is a temperature sensing wire with a set temperature of 80°C. It is a product that integrates a large number of shape memory alloys at equal intervals along an extended electric wire, which is attached to the electric equipment's wiring using spiral tubes, monitoring abnormal temperatures caused by overload current in the wire or poor connections, as well as abnormal temperatures due to faults in electrical equipment. It enables safety management of electrical equipment even for those who are not electrical engineers. When the surrounding temperature reaches the set temperature (80°C), the two wires short-circuit to sense the temperature, triggering a mechanism to detect abnormal temperatures as a signal. It utilizes the softening of the wire and the recovery of the shape memory alloy. With permanent memory and no rust, it retains its function indefinitely once activated and can be used for many years. Additionally, it is a non-reset type that allows for confirmation after activation, is simple and easy to use, has good accuracy, and features zero standby power due to its switching function. A new product for temperature sensing (70℃) that can directly sense temperature and signal through a physical operation without the need for power.
This product is a temperature sensing wire set to 70°C that can directly sense temperature and signal without the need for power or measuring devices. It is a product that combines a large number of shape memory alloys at equal intervals along an extended wire. The shape memory alloy is attached to the wire in a coiled shape, and when the surrounding temperature reaches 70°C, the wire softens, causing the shape memory alloy to constrict the wire (restoring it) and short-circuiting the two wires to create a temperature sensing signal. It is suitable for installation in locations where abnormal temperatures that could lead to fires may occur, such as in industrial machinery, industrial equipment, electrical devices, and storage batteries, and can alert the surroundings to abnormal temperatures using alarms. New product of temperature detection sensor with code for detecting abnormal temperatures in various industrial equipment.
1. This is a product that connects a temperature detection sensor with a code. It is connected using crimp sleeves or connectors. 2. The temperature detection sensor is equipped with a shape memory alloy coiled around a soluble insulated wire. When the surrounding temperature reaches the set temperature (80°C), the wire softens, and the shape memory alloy constricts the wire (restores), short-circuiting the two wires to detect temperature and sending a signal (no voltage/a contact) for temperature detection. 3. By setting the temperature detection sensor to the abnormal temperature of the equipment, it can detect abnormal temperatures. In other words, by installing temperature detection sensors on various industrial and equipment devices, it can detect abnormal temperatures that may lead to equipment damage or fire. The abnormal temperature is set to the set temperature (80°C). 5. For example, when installed on various industrial and electrical equipment, if abnormal heat (abnormal temperature) occurs, the temperature detection sensor with a code detects the abnormal temperature and alerts through an alarm or similar device. 6. In this way, abnormal temperatures of various industrial and electrical equipment can be monitored continuously on a daily basis, allowing for early detection and initial response to prevent equipment damage or fire. Maintenance management is reliable and safe.
